1. Bali & Panormo Rethymno: Quad Safari & visit Cave 57km 4hours

Bali & Panormo Rethymno:Quad Safari & visit Cave 57km 4hours

If you’re after an adventurous way to explore Crete’s countryside, this Quad Safari is a top pick. Starting from Bali Travel Agency, you’ll hop on a quad bike and cross rugged terrain, winding through olive groves and small villages. This tour isn’t just about the thrill of riding—it includes stops at nine traditional villages, where you can admire Venetian and Ottoman-style stone buildings and briefly meet local residents. The highlight for many is the visit to Cave of Melidoni, famous for its stalactites and stalagmites, and its historical significance.

What makes this tour stand out is the balance of adventure and culture. Your guide, Oswald, is praised for making the experience fun and informative—”He really made the tour amazing,” writes one reviewer. The scenery is striking: views of the valley and the Psiloritis mountain provide perfect photo ops. The tour lasts around four hours, making it a solid half-day option, and includes a visit to a cave that’s both beautiful and historically meaningful.

Bottom line: Ideal for active travelers who want a taste of local Crete without sacrificing adventure. It’s especially good if you like off-road driving and authentic village encounters.

2. Panormo Catamaran Cruise: Swim, Snorkel & Gourmet Lunch

Panormo Catamaran Cruise: Swim, Snorkel & Gourmet Lunch

For a more relaxed day, the Panormo Catamaran Cruise offers a luxurious way to enjoy the coast. Setting sail from Panormo, this semi-private cruise takes you to Bali Bay, known for its crystal-clear waters. You’ll enjoy a spacious, comfortable boat with plenty of deck space to lounge while taking in the coastal scenery. The cruise includes a gourmet Mediterranean lunch, with options for kids, alongside fresh drinks like wine, beer, coffee, and soft drinks.

What’s special here is the combination of scenic sailing and water activities. Snorkeling, paddleboarding (SUP), and even fishing are available, making it suitable for both active water lovers and those wanting to relax. The itinerary features a stop at Bali Bay, with opportunities to swim, snorkel, and unwind. The cruise lasts about six and a half to seven hours, making it a leisurely day on the water.

Most reviews emphasize the quality of the boat, the delicious lunch, and the scenic coastal views. It’s a good fit for couples, families, or anyone wanting to soak up the Crete shoreline in comfort.

Bottom line: Perfect for travelers seeking an elegant, laid-back experience with plenty of water fun and excellent food.

3. Catamaran Sunset Cruises

Catamaran Sunset Cruises

Nothing beats ending a day in Crete with a sunset sail. This Catamaran Sunset Cruise takes you along the coast, returning to Panormo or Bali port as the sky transforms into shades of orange and pink. It’s a short but memorable 4.5-hour experience where you can enjoy cool drinks and fresh fruit while watching the sun dip below the horizon.

The highlight is, of course, the spectacular sunset, with the sky painted in hues that make every photo look like a postcard. During the cruise, there’s also an opportunity to snorkel in the turquoise waters, adding a splash of adventure to the relaxing cruise. The calm waters and gentle breeze make it ideal for those who want to unwind in style after a day of sightseeing or beach lounging.

Reviewers mention the calm atmosphere and stunning views as major pluses, making this cruise suitable for couples or anyone looking for a peaceful evening. The inclusion of drinks and fruit at this price point adds to its appeal.

Bottom line: An excellent choice if you want to experience Crete’s natural beauty and unwind with a drink in hand as the day ends.

How to Choose

When deciding between these options, consider your preferences and travel style. If you’re looking for a high-energy outdoor adventure, the Quad Safari offers off-road fun and cultural stops. For a day of leisure on the sea, the Catamaran Cruise provides comfort, water activities, and excellent food. Meanwhile, the Sunset Cruise is perfect for those who want a relaxed, scenic experience ending their day with breathtaking views.

Budget-wise, expect to pay around $171 for the full-day cruise, which is good value considering the length and inclusions. The quad safari costs less and is more active, making it ideal for travelers wanting a mix of adventure and local encounters.

Timing is also key. The quad safari is best during the dry season when off-road paths are accessible, while the cruises are suitable year-round, with sunset cruises being especially magical in spring and summer.
